Sheet Metal Fabrication Contributes to Lightweight Construction in Engineering

Posted on July 13, 2025July 15, 2025 by Daniel

Sheet metal fabrication plays a vital role in advancing lightweight construction within the engineering industry. As engineers and manufacturers strive to improve efficiency, performance, and sustainability, the use of sheet metal offers a practical solution to reduce weight without compromising strength or durability. This process involves cutting, bending, and shaping thin metal sheets into various parts and components that are essential in sectors like automotive, aerospace, and construction. Lightweight structures help enhance fuel efficiency, lower material costs, and reduce environmental impact, making sheet metal fabrication a key contributor to modern engineering advancements.

Sheet Metal Fabrication Supports Lightweight Construction

Sheet metal fabrication allows engineers to design and produce parts that are both strong and light. The process focuses on maximizing the strength-to-weight ratio, which is crucial for lightweight construction goals. Here are the main ways TZR sheet metal fabrication contributes to this:

  • Material Efficiency: Thin metal sheets require less raw material compared to bulkier alternatives, reducing overall weight.
  • High Strength Materials: Metals like aluminum and high-strength steel used in sheet form offer excellent strength with minimal weight.
  • Precision Manufacturing: Fabrication methods such as laser cutting and CNC bending produce accurate, thin components with less waste.
  • Custom Design Flexibility: Fabrication allows for complex shapes that optimize structural support without adding unnecessary mass.

The Perks of Lightweight Construction Through Sheet Metal Fabrication

Using sheet metal fabrication for lightweight construction delivers several key benefits:

  • Improved Fuel Efficiency: Lighter vehicles and aircraft require less energy to move, cutting fuel consumption and emissions.
  • Enhanced Performance: Reduced weight contributes to better speed, handling, and maneuverability in engineering applications.
  • Cost Savings: Less material use lowers production costs and transportation expenses due to lighter loads.
  • Sustainability: Lighter structures mean less resource consumption and smaller carbon footprints in manufacturing and operation.
  • Durability: Despite being lightweight, fabricated sheet metal parts maintain structural integrity and resist wear and corrosion.

Common Applications in Engineering

Lightweight construction with sheet metal fabrication is widely applied across various engineering fields:

  • Automotive Industry: Body panels, chassis components, and engine parts benefit from lighter sheet metal to improve vehicle efficiency and safety.
  • Aerospace: Aircraft fuselages and interior components use sheet metal for strong, lightweight designs crucial for flight performance.
  • Construction: Roofing, cladding, and support frameworks use fabricated metal sheets for durable, lightweight building solutions.
  • Electronics: Lightweight enclosures and frames protect devices while keeping overall weight low.
